Overview
Criminal Brigade (Spanish:Brigada criminal) is a 1950 Spanish crime film directed by Ignacio F. Iquino and starring José Suarez, Soledad Lence and Alfonso Estela. It is a film noir with large amounts of location shooting in Madrid.
Plot
Fernando Olmos, a recently graduated police officer, witnesses a bank robbery, although he cannot do anything to prevent it. His first job is to infiltrate a garage as a car washer to catch a thief, unaware that the owner of the establishment is also the head of the robbery gang.
The film ends with a shocking sequence: the fight against the robbers in a building under construction: the Francisco Franco Health Residence, now the Valle de Hebrón Hospital in Barcelona.
